London thief caught after being knocked off Boris Bike

A London local authority has released CCTV footage of a thief ransacking the contents of a range rover then attempting to make good his escape on a so-called Boris Bike.<br /><br />Although the pay-as-you-go two-wheelers are not known as the most nimble or agile of bicycles, 31-year-old Jake Nedd deemed them to be the ideal getaway vehicle for his crime.<br /><br />However, the police soon arrived after receiving a call from members of Hammersmith & Fulham Council’s CCTV team and apprehended Nedd after using the door of their van to knock him of his bike. <br /><br />He has since been sentenced to 28 weeks in prison for his crimes.<br /><br />Inspector Richard Berns, tweeted the footage, along with the words: “This criminal tried to get away, but thanks to the driving of A/PS Field & a (small + proportionate) nudge from me, he got 28 weeks instead.”<br /><br />A/PS refers to “acting police sergeant.”<br />
